Specifications:
Material: ABS
Product size: 98*34*10mm/3.85*1.33*0.39 inches
Rated voltage: 12 volts (V)
Rated current: 10 milliamperes (mA)
Installation mode: wireless
Corresponding frequency: 315MHz, 433MHz
Modulation mode: ASK
Wireless transmission distance: 50-100 meters (in an open space)
Application: Suitable for garage doors, alarms, automatic doors, rolling doors, etc.
Type of copied chip: 2260 (e.g., PT2260, SC2260, LX2260, HX2260); 2262 (such as PT2262, SC2262, LX2262, HS2262, HX2262, etc.), PT2264, PT2240 (LX2240), 1527 (such as EV1527, HS1527, HX1527), FP527, CS5211, SMC918, SMC926, AX5026, ax5326-3, ax5326-4, HT600, HT680, HT6207, HT6010, HT6012, HT6013, HT6014, HT12D, HT46F49E, PIC16F629, PIC16F630, etc. It can also copy other types of chips compatible with the above-mentioned chips. Different chip manufacturers will have different prefix chip models, as long as the chip model number is part of the same, it can be copied.
Note: We generally do not recommend copying roll code chips due to the uncertainty involved. When copying a roll code chip remote control, we cannot determine whether the original remote control chip is an encryption chip or not, and we do not recommend copying roll code remote controls with a pair of remote controls.
Operation Manual:
1. Code Clearing: Simultaneously hold the lock with two keys (some shells have two keys) upward and downward until the LED indicator flashes three times. Then, press and hold any one of the keys while releasing the other. Click the released button three times rapidly, and the LED light will enter the state of memory data clearing. After clearing the data of the remote control, press any key, and the LED indicator will turn on.
2. Copying: Hold the original remote controller in one hand and the copy remote controller in the other hand. Keep the two remote controllers as close as possible (ideally side by side on the desktop). Press the required copy buttons on both remote controllers. The LED indicator will flash quickly three times after three flickers, indicating successful copying. Repeat the same procedure for other keys. Some remote controllers have low transmitting power, so they should be operated with the back-to-back method for copying to cope well. Avoid interference in some operating environments, and if copying is not successful, try again after code clearance.
3. Recovery: If you accidentally clear the code of the copying remote controller, press the bottom two keys of the copying remote controller simultaneously. After three flashes of the LED lamp, it will flicker quickly. Release the keys, press any key again, and the light will stay on, indicating that the code of the copying remote controller has been restored. Before using our copy remote control to copy, please make sure to clear the existing code of the copy remote control first.
4. How to control some of the keys after copying, and the rest cannot be controlled: You can use the tips of cleaning and restoring operation. The specific operation is as follows:
(1) Clear the code first.
(2) Copy the keys that have not been successfully copied again after the successful code clearance, and do not copy the keys that have been successfully copied before.
(3) Clear the code again.
(4) Perform a restore operation once; at this time, the key that had not been successfully copied will be covered by the new copy code, while the original copy of the successful code will be retained. If there are still keys that have not been successfully copied after the second copy, repeat the coding, restoring, and copying process until all keys are successfully copied. This little trick can be used to reduce the hassle of repetitive operations.
Warm Tips:
1. Prerequisites for selecting the duplicate remote controller: the original remote controller has normal function, the remote control chip is the same or compatible, and the remote control work frequency is the same.
2. The copying remote controller can only copy fixed code, learning code chip, and remote controller of some single-chip computers (the type of chip that can be copied is shown in the description of the type of chip that can be copied).
3. Two-way remote controllers, scroll code remote controllers, and single-chip encryption program remote controllers cannot be copied. Examples include HCS200, HCS201, HCS300, HCS301, etc.
4. Before copying the remote controller, make sure that the existing code of the remote controller has been cleared, and check whether the code has been cleared successfully. Otherwise, replication is not possible.
5. Make sure your remote controller has enough power when copying. The closer the two remote controllers are, the better. If the copy distance is too close, you can copy from different angles. Press the button of the original remote control to ensure that the transmitting signal is completely normal, and then press the button of the duplicate remote control to ensure that the function is completely duplicated.
